New Delhi: The much awaited mythological epic Mahavat Narasimha today marked his presence at the Grand Rath Yatra ceremony in Noida, and further enhanced the discussion around the film. As the inaugural chapter of the Mahavatar Cinematic Universe, the film has already attracted significant attention with its impressive poster, powerful soundtrack and ambitious tale.
In a symbolic gesture, a poster of Mahavatar Narasima was displayed prominently on the Rath Yatra vehicles, reflecting the growing cultural resonance and outreach of the film. The relationship with the Sacred Festival underlines the deep spiritual and devotion themes of the film, which well aligns with a portrayal of one of the most prestigious incarnations of Lord Vishnu.
Earlier this month, the creators unveiled a huge cinematic slate, including seven films, each dedicated to a separate avatar of Lord Vishnu. This announcement has promoted anticipation among the audience, especially among the followers of Bhakti cinema.
Manufactured by Shilpa Dhawan, Kushal Desai, and Chaitanya Desai under Claim Productions, Mahavatar Narasima is presented by homebell films, which is famous for distributing material-powered blockbosters. The film promises a mixture of mythological grandeur, immersive storytelling and high-end visual effects, and will be released in 3D in five Indian languages.

Mahavatar Narasimha is directed by Ashwin Kumar and is produced by Shilpa Dhawan, Kushal Desai and Chaitanya Desai under the claim production banner. The film is presented by Homebell Films, a studio behind many acclaimed Pan-Indian hits. This cooperation brings together the creative vision and production scale, aiming to give a cinematic spectacle that spreads mythology and modern story.
The combination visual grandeur, cultural depth, and narrative excellence, Mahavatar Narasimha will be released on July 25, 2025 in 3D and five Indian languages.
